Well after doing my weekend chores taking the trash to dump and mowing the lawn I decided to go “Tinkering” in my shop and make some feather rests for several incoming bows I resented won in a bidding war. Last week my brother called me at work and said a guy on the farm where he’s tilling ground had a set of Turkey wings in the back of his truck and to come get them. Well I went there and sure enough there they were thrown in back of his work truck so I took them home and clipped off what I could and started to split the feathers for a later date . So today I decided let’s make a few feather rests so here are the final results . Trap still makes the best I’ve ever seen but these will do .

Here’s a few more I did today and added them to the ones I made yesterday . I had to cut and grind these from feathers I was gifted from a generous leather Waller and a set of Turkey wings I got last week . A few years ago I made over 100 and I’ve kept just a few and gave many away and did some trading . These take a lot of work if you don’t have feathers that have been processed or ground . Anyway I took a picture before the sun went down outside and wanted to share what I’ve done so far. I have plans for these an will show them in a few weeks on a few bows coming my way. Keefers

Thanks everyone but “ Trap” is still the best I’ve seen .I really like his yellow dyed ones I’ve seen .I had some Osage feathers that were in the box that was gifted to me so I made two using Orange then natural and so on . The other one I put the natural on the outside and every other an orange to give it a different look. I’ll be using those possibly on two rosewood bows heading my way shortly. I think they will look good on it but I’ll have to wait and see when they arrive .
